This video shows you how to install a new windshield washer fluid reservoir on your 2007-2011 Toyota Camry. Keeping a fresh supply of windshield washer fluid to keep your windshield clear is essential for visibility and safety. If your washer fluid reservoir is leaking or broken, you can replace it yourself!
This repair was done on a 2007 Toyota Camry SE 2.4L Sedan 4-Door FWD Automatic and the process should be similar on the following vehicles:
2007 Toyota Camry
2008 Toyota Camry
2009 Toyota Camry
2010 Toyota Camry
2011 Toyota Camry
